One More Scalp

> In factual terms the news was brief. Under Secretary of State Sumner Welles had resigned.

> In political terms the news was complex. When would Franklin Roosevelt cease his appeasement of Southern Democrats, who had forced Welles's resignation, and how would U.S. foreign policy be affected?

> In human terms the news was repetitious. Cordell Hull had again got his man.

> [In journalistic terms] the news had been foreseen (TIME, Aug. 23). But rumors of dissension had been consistently denied by Cordell Hull, who accused newsmen of seeing smoke where there was no fire.
